Brussels, (Brussels Morning)- A discussion arose in the Brussels parliament on Thursday after Minister Alain Maron (Ecolo) announced that he would have to leave the committee to pick up his child from the nursery. “Women have been working for decades and have never been approached with the same leniency as men.”

This week there was a commotion in the Flemish parliament after Liesbeth Homans (N-VA), as speaker of parliament, said that “children can stay with their daddy” if the childcare has to close.
